Bexley LEA (Cluster Project)
Nineteen primary schools are involved in this cluster. It aims to draw on the NIAS project in order to embed improvement and link it to school development plans.

Programme
The aim of the programme is to raise the profile of the investigative nature of science in schools.
The idea is to extend investigative science by improving skills and confidence. Audits of resources and training needs over several sections of the National Curriculum have helped the cluster frame its subject priorities. The programme includes:
- training for teachers, co-ordinators or whole groups working on specific elements to more expansive activities such as science weeks and science clubs
- emphasis on the use of ICT by all
- surgeries for co-ordinators and focused training for small groups
We held a Science Fest in January at a local shopping centre. Bursted Woods, one of the AstraZeneca Science Teaching Trust funded schools, participated in activities with London Power Networks and the Schools Waste Action Club (SWAC).
